一次TP钱包转账中,备注出现乱码,表面是体验问题,实则牵扯编码、链上存储与隐私风险。对1000笔样本交易的量化分析显https://www.xjapqil.com ,示,6.7%存在备注异常;在异常样本中,编码不匹配(UTF-8/GBK)占72%,超长截断占18%,客户端渲染错误占10%。分析流程包括数据采集、字节流解析、编码假设验证与回归测试。技术观察:区块链使用默克尔树保证交易完整性,但备注通常作为字节负载写入交易,不参与默克尔分支的语义层处理,这导致链上可见性与客户端解码耦合。基于此,

提出两条路径:一是信息化科技路径——标准化钱包SDK采用UTF-8、百分号编码与长度前缀,增加兼容层与回退逻辑,同时建立监测指标(错误率、回退调用率);二是隐私与抗肩窥路径——将长文本或敏感备注离链存储,仅在链上提交备注哈希并以默克尔根锚定,客户端通过授权或零知识证明按需揭示。防肩窥的具体措施包括UI端短码代替长文本、一次性二维码、短时可见开关,以及在可信执行环境内渲染确认界面。新兴技术如TEE、阈值签名与零知识证明,有助在保证可验证性的同时降低信息暴露窗口。专业观点:解决备注乱码既需修复编码错误,更需重构信息传递链路——用编码标准降低误差,用默克尔承诺与离链策略保护隐私,用更安全的显示逻辑

减少肩窥风险。实施建议:第一阶段(0–3个月)完成SDK兼容补丁与监测;第二阶段(3–6个月)试点离链存储与默克尔锚定;第三阶段评估TEE与零知识方案的可用性与成本。解决乱码是小修,重构信息路径是大工程。
作者:林亦辰发布时间:2026-02-18 06:43:33
评论
Alex77
数据支持很有说服力,建议加入更多兼容测试。
李清
把备注从链上抽离并用默克尔根绑定,这个思路值得试验。
CryptoChen
防肩窥的UX细节同样重要,短码+确认延时可行。
小吴
想看样本数据和脚本,能分享复现方法吗?